Searched refs:SubVec (Results 1 – 5 of 5) sorted by relevance
/external/llvm/lib/CodeGen/SelectionDAG/ |
D | LegalizeVectorTypes.cpp | 848 SDValue SubVec = N->getOperand(1); in SplitVecRes_INSERT_SUBVECTOR() local 856 unsigned SubElems = SubVec.getValueType().getVectorNumElements(); in SplitVecRes_INSERT_SUBVECTOR() 869 Lo = DAG.getNode(ISD::INSERT_SUBVECTOR, dl, LoVT, Lo, SubVec, Idx); in SplitVecRes_INSERT_SUBVECTOR() 883 Store = DAG.getStore(Store, dl, SubVec, SubVecPtr, MachinePointerInfo(), in SplitVecRes_INSERT_SUBVECTOR()
|
/external/llvm/lib/Target/X86/ |
D | X86ISelLowering.cpp | 4559 SDValue SubVec = Op.getOperand(1); in insert1BitVector() local 4570 MVT SubVecVT = SubVec.getSimpleValueType(); in insert1BitVector() 4594 Undef, SubVec, ZeroIdx); in insert1BitVector() 4630 SubVec, ZeroIdx); in insert1BitVector() 4649 SubVec, ZeroIdx); in insert1BitVector() 12753 SDValue SubVec = Op.getOperand(1); in LowerINSERT_SUBVECTOR() local 12761 MVT SubVecVT = SubVec.getSimpleValueType(); in LowerINSERT_SUBVECTOR() 12781 SDValue Ops[] = { SubVec2, SubVec }; in LowerINSERT_SUBVECTOR() 12791 return insert128BitVector(Vec, SubVec, IdxVal, DAG, dl); in LowerINSERT_SUBVECTOR() 12794 return insert256BitVector(Vec, SubVec, IdxVal, DAG, dl); in LowerINSERT_SUBVECTOR() [all …]
|
/external/llvm/lib/Target/ARM/ |
D | ARMISelLowering.cpp | 10310 SDValue SubVec = DAG.getNode(ISD::EXTRACT_VECTOR_ELT, DL, in PerformSTORECombine() local 10313 SDValue Ch = DAG.getStore(St->getChain(), DL, SubVec, BasePtr, in PerformSTORECombine() 12625 Value *SubVec = Builder.CreateExtractValue(VldN, Index); in lowerInterleavedLoad() local 12629 SubVec = Builder.CreateIntToPtr(SubVec, SV->getType()); in lowerInterleavedLoad() 12631 SV->replaceAllUsesWith(SubVec); in lowerInterleavedLoad()
|
/external/llvm/lib/Target/AArch64/ |
D | AArch64ISelLowering.cpp | 7139 Value *SubVec = Builder.CreateExtractValue(LdN, Index); in lowerInterleavedLoad() local 7143 SubVec = Builder.CreateIntToPtr(SubVec, SVI->getType()); in lowerInterleavedLoad() 7145 SVI->replaceAllUsesWith(SubVec); in lowerInterleavedLoad()
|
/external/swiftshader/third_party/LLVM/lib/Target/X86/ |
D | X86ISelLowering.cpp | 7155 SDValue SubVec = Op.getNode()->getOperand(1); in LowerINSERT_SUBVECTOR() local 7159 && SubVec.getNode()->getValueType(0).getSizeInBits() == 128) { in LowerINSERT_SUBVECTOR() 7160 return Insert128BitVector(Vec, SubVec, Idx, DAG, dl); in LowerINSERT_SUBVECTOR() 13708 SDValue SubVec = DAG.getNode(ISD::EXTRACT_VECTOR_ELT, dl, in PerformSTORECombine() local 13711 SDValue Ch = DAG.getStore(St->getChain(), dl, SubVec, Ptr, in PerformSTORECombine()
|